How to Scrape 2000 Instagram Profiles?

Extract data from Instagram Profile for free in just one click.

Quickly access detailed location information.

In 2025, building a strong contact list from Instagram is a smart move for marketers, agencies, and businesses. But manually collecting data from 2,000 profiles is nearly impossible unless you want to spend weeks doing it.

The smarter way? Use a reliable IG Profile Scraper that automates the entire process, saves time, and gives you verified results.

This blog post explains step-by-step how you can scrape 2,000 public Instagram profiles efficiently using the IG Profile Scraper by LeadStal. We’ll also show how this tool helps you collect accurate emails, bios, phone numbers, and more — all in a few hours instead of days.

Why You Might Want to Scrape 2,000 Instagram Profiles

Here are a few reasons businesses and professionals scrape such a large number of profiles:

  • To build an email marketing list for promotions
  • To collect leads for cold outreach
  • For influencer research and collaboration
  • For competitive analysis and benchmarking
  • For market research and niche targeting

Instagram is full of potential leads. But you’ll only get results if you use the right method — and that’s where an IG Profile Scraper comes in.

What Is an IG Profile Scraper?

An IG Profile Scraper is a Chrome extension or software that pulls public data from Instagram profiles automatically.

Instead of visiting each profile and copying details manually, this tool extracts:

  • Full Name
  • Username
  • Bio
  • Emails (if public)
  • Phone number (if public)
  • Website link
  • Follower/following count
  • Profile photo
  • Engagement metrics (likes, comments, post pricing, story pricing)

This makes data collection much faster, and the data can be exported in Excel or CSV format.

How LeadStal’s IG Profile Scraper Makes It Easy

LeadStal’s IG Profile Scraper is one of the best tools in 2025 for high-volume Instagram data scraping. It’s designed for speed, accuracy, and ease of use — especially for scraping thousands of profiles at once.

Features That Help You Scrape 2000 Profiles:

  • ✅ Bulk scraping support
  • ✅ Verified emails and phone data
  • ✅ 99.5% data accuracy
  • ✅ Exportable formats (CSV, Excel)
  • ✅ Real-time scraping
  • ✅ Automatic email validation
  • ✅ Works inside Chrome browser

Even if you’ve never scraped data before, LeadStal’s user-friendly design makes the process simple.

Step-by-Step Guide to Scraping 2000 Instagram Profiles

Step 1: Install the IG Profile Scraper Extension

Follow these steps to install the extension:

  1. Download the extension ZIP file
  2. Unzip the folder
  3. Go to chrome://extensions
  4. Enable Developer Mode
  5. Click Load unpacked
  6. Select the extracted folder

The IG Profile Scraper will now be active in your browser.

Step 2: Gather or Create a List of Instagram Usernames

You’ll need a list of Instagram profile URLs or usernames you want to scrape. You can collect these from:

  • Search results by niche or keyword
  • Competitor follower lists
  • Influencer directories
  • Hashtag searches
  • Previous saved links

You can scrape profiles one-by-one or use a batch process for larger volumes.

Step 3: Start Scraping the Profiles

  1. Open Instagram in Chrome
  2. Visit a target profile
  3. Click the “Profile Leads” button from the extension
  4. Let the scraper extract all public information
  5. Export the results in CSV/Excel

Repeat the process or use multiple tabs to speed things up. LeadStal allows bulk processing, which means you can run scrapes across many profiles simultaneously.

Step 4: Use the Data for Outreach or Research

Once you have data from 2,000 profiles, you can:

  • Import emails into your email marketing software
  • Use contact info for direct sales outreach
  • Analyze engagement and follower stats
  • Identify influencers with good ROI
  • Build custom audiences for paid ads

The possibilities are wide, depending on your goal.

How Long Does It Take to Scrape 2,000 Profiles?

Using LeadStal’s IG Profile Scraper, most users can scrape 2,000 profiles in under 2–3 hours, depending on internet speed and system capacity.

Here’s a comparison:

MethodProfiles per HourTime to Scrape 2,000
Manual40–5040+ hours
LeadStal Tool2,000+1–2 hours

This shows how much time and energy automation can save you.

How Many Credits Do You Need?

LeadStal charges 1 credit per profile, so for 2,000 profiles, you’ll need 2,000 credits.

Here’s a breakdown of pricing:

PlanPriceCredits
Free Plan$020 credits
Standard Plan$14.992,800 credits
Business Plan$4710,000 credits
Premium Plan$250Unlimited

👉 Check all pricing options

For scraping 2,000 profiles, the Standard Plan is usually the best option for small to mid-sized campaigns.

What Kind of Data Will You Get?

LeadStal scrapes the following fields from public Instagram accounts:

CategoryData
Profile InfoName, username, profile image
Contact InfoEmail, phone, website, social links
EngagementLikes, comments, post cost, story cost
Content TypePosts, Reels, IGTV, profile type

All data is downloadable in spreadsheet format.

Is It Legal and Safe?

Yes. The IG Profile Scraper only collects public data — information that users have already made visible on their profiles. It doesn’t break into private accounts or misuse the platform.

LeadStal also ensures your data is safe during the process. You don’t need to log in with your Instagram account or share passwords.

Final Thoughts

If you're trying to scrape 2,000 Instagram profiles, using a reliable tool like LeadStal's IG Profile Scraper is the best decision you can make.

It’s fast, accurate, easy to use, and affordable. Whether you're running marketing campaigns, sales outreach, or just doing research, this tool gives you the edge by removing manual steps and providing clean, ready-to-use data.

The best part? You don’t need any tech skills. Just install, click, and export.

🔗 Start scraping with LeadStal now

Related Blog Post

FAQs

1. Can I really scrape 2,000 profiles in one day? Yes. With LeadStal, it’s possible to scrape 2,000 or more profiles in just a few hours.

2. Will I get valid emails and phone numbers? Yes, if the data is publicly available, the tool will extract and verify it.

3. Do I need to pay extra for bulk scraping? No extra cost — just make sure you have enough credits based on your chosen plan.

4. Can I use the data for email marketing? Yes, but always follow email marketing laws (like GDPR and CAN-SPAM).

5. Does this work on mobile devices? No. You’ll need a desktop with the Chrome browser to use the tool.

6. Can I use it for influencer analysis? Absolutely. You can analyze followers, engagement, and post pricing.

7. What format will the data be in? You can export the scraped data in CSV or Excel format.

8. How many profiles can I scrape with the free plan? You can scrape up to 20 profiles with the free plan.

9. Is there customer support? Yes, LeadStal offers 24/7 support and video tutorials for all users.

10. Is it safe for my computer? Yes, the tool runs in your browser and doesn’t access sensitive data.

WhatsApp